Nutritious Eating for All Ages

 Nutrition forms the cornerstone of family health. Incorporating diverse and nutritious food items like f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ins into every meal ensures a balanced dietary intake. Involving kids in cooking processes, such as picking recipes or assisting in meal prep, fosters an early appreciation for healthy eating. Educating family members about the benefits of nutritious foods and the pitfalls of excessive junk food is also essential. Remember, instilling healthy eating habits in children sets the foundation for their future well-being.

Staying Active Together

 Regular physical activity is a non-negotiable aspect of a healthy lifestyle. Family activities, whether weekend nature hikes, evening walks, or joining a community sports league, improve physical health and strengthen emotional bonds. Tailoring activities to suit different family members' interests ensures that everyone stays engaged and motivated. Celebrating small victories and setting collective goals, like participating in a local charity run, can also enhance the family's commitment to staying active.

The Power of Quality Sleep

Good sleep is essential for health and well-being. Establishing a bedtime routine, such as reading a book or taking a warm bath, can signal to the body that it's time to wind down. Ensuring bedrooms are conducive to sleep, with comfortable mattresses and minimal light and noise, is critical. Discussing the importance of sleep with children and setting an example by adhering to sleep routines can reinforce these habits. Remember, adequate sleep is a key component of a healthy lifestyle.

Fostering Emotional and Mental Well-being

 Mental and emotional health is as important as physical health. Regular family meetings where everyone can share their feelings, challenges, and successes foster a supportive environment. Engaging in shared activities, such as gardening, cooking, or art projects, can strengthen emotional connections. Introducing gratitude journals or mindfulness exercises can improve mental well-being and help manage stress. It’s important to recognize and address mental health issues promptly, seeking professional help if necessary.
